
The internet has been a buzz with this wild collection of videos about the question “Would 100 men win a fight against a fully grown gorilla”? (Silverback Ape is what most people are picturing). While a gorilla is incredibly strong, 100 men would likely be able to overcome a single adult male gorilla, but it would be a costly victory. The gorilla’s strength and speed would mean significant casualties among the men, especially in the initial stages. However, the sheer number of men, along with coordinated tactics and potentially the use of weapons, could eventually allow them to overpower the gorilla.
Here’s a more detailed breakdown:
- Gorilla Strength: Silverback gorillas are incredibly strong, capable of lifting several times their own weight. Their bite force is also powerful.
- Human Advantage: 100 men provide a significant numerical advantage.
- Costly Victory: The initial phase would likely be brutal, with the gorilla inflicting significant damage on the attacking men.
- Coordination and Strategy: Successful outcomes would require careful planning, coordination, and possibly the use of weapons or tools to disarm the gorilla.
- Potential for Loss: Even with a victory, the men would likely suffer casualties and injuries.
- Not a guaranteed win: The gorilla could win or inflict immense damage if the men are not prepared and coordinated, according to Newsweek.
